Newly endangered animals include desert frogs and snails in extreme ocean depths, both threatened by mining

Mining for diamonds has put another extraordinary creature at risk of disappearing – the desert rain frog. Most frogs rely on water for survival but the bulbous desert rain frog has evolved to need almost none. It hides from the southern African sun by burying itself deep in the sand, coming out only at night to hunt insects.

However, dwindling species can be saved, the International Union for Conservation of Nature (IUCN), which produces the red list, said. The new list shows the numbat, a stripy, termite-eating marsupial from Australia, has come back from the brink thanks to protection from feral cats and foxes.

“Life on Earth has adapted to survive in the most hostile and unusual habitats [but] as pressures on biodiversity mount across the planet, even the creatures with the most ingenious survival strategies are under threat,” said Dr Grethel Aguilar, the IUCN director general. “But there is a clear path out of the biodiversity crisis: nature conservation works. By protecting the astounding range of biodiversity on this planet, we can preserve a welcoming environment for humans and wildlife alike.”

An IUCN update in April declared emperor penguins officially in danger of extinction owing to the mass drowning of chicks as sea ice is melted by the climate crisis.

More than 200 species of mollusc are known to live only on hydrothermal vents, where water heated by volcanic rocks jets out from the seabed. Many have been discovered only in the last decade but already face extinction.

The exploration and extraction of deep-sea minerals throws up sediments that smother the animals. One snail, Lirapex felix, is classed as critically endangered because of mining activity in the Indian Ocean.

However, more than 30 vent species are not in danger, as they live in marine protected areas where mining is not allowed. These include an ornately shelled snail, Provanna exquisita, that lives only in the Mariana Arc of Fire national wildlife refuge in the Pacific Ocean.

“This global assessment reveals that [vent] molluscs are one of the most highly threatened of all animal groups,” said Prof Julia Sigwart at Senckenberg Nature Research, the IUCN red list partner that coordinated the assessment. “It provides important information as the International Seabed Authority meets in Jamaica this month.” The IUCN voted for a moratorium on deep-sea mining in 2021.

The desert rain frog is classed as vulnerable owing to diamond mining and energy infrastructure expansion into its range along the west coast of South Africa and Namibia. There is further pressure on the frog because of rising demand from the exotic pet trade following a viral video of the species squeaking its distress call.

The good news on the numbat comes after decades of conservation work, which has helped numbers rebound from a low of just 300 in the late 1970s to between 2,000 and 3,000 today. The numbat has moved from endangered to near threatened on the red list.

The impact of feral cats and red foxes has been reduced by baiting and predator-proof fencing, as well as captive breeding at Perth zoo and translocations from healthy groups. As a result, at least five more self-sustaining populations have been established. However, the species occupies only 0.04% of its original range across southern Australia, meaning continuing conservation work is essential, experts said.

Another five Australian marsupials have been confirmed as extinct on the red list, with no sightings for at least 60 years. The crest-tailed, southern, northern and little mulgaras were rat-sized carnivores, while the little bettong was a rabbit-sized jumping marsupial. They are likely to have fallen prey to feral cats and foxes. More than 40 modern mammal extinctions have been recorded in Australia.

“The [numbat] assessment shows that long-term conservation effort works; without it, invasive cats and foxes will continue to drive Australia’s small marsupials and native rodents to extinction,” said Prof John Woinarski, co-chair of the IUCN species survival commission group on Australasian marsupials and monotremes.

“Continued management is vital not only to maintain the numbat’s unique evolutionary line as the last surviving member of the Myrmecobiidae family, but also to support its role in maintaining a healthy ecosystem, as digging for the termites it eats increases rain penetration into the soil, helping protect woodlands,” he said.

The IUCN red list includes 175,909 species of which 49,505 are threatened with extinction, although many species have yet to be formally assessed.

Roundup - Miracle Product or Public Menace? -

 by Larry Powell

circa 2010


Despite copious evidence that the globally-popular weed-killer may be harmful to crops, livestock and humans, the Government of Canada seems in no hurry to act. Last June, Health Canada (which regulates pesticides) announced it was aware of such evidence, but, that, "It did not raise immediate risk concerns that would have triggered regulatory action." Then, in November, the Federal Court ordered the Minister of Health, Leona Aglukkaq, to reconsider a decision she had made in August, 2009. That's when she turned down a citizen's request for a "special" review of the product. The Minister settled instead for a longer-range, routine re-evaluation. That didn't begin until some two years later and won't be finished for about another two. That court order came down some 10 weeks ago. As this story goes to press, the Minister is still "reconsidering" the matter. 


Ask most conventional farmers about Roundup, they'll tell you. It's a chemical they spray regularly on their canola, soybeans or corn, just after they come up, to get rid of weeds. Sometimes, they also apply it in the fall to cereal crops like wheat and barley as a "desiccant," to dry them out, in preparation for harvest. 


The seeds used to grow the crops have been altered to resist Roundup, by adding a gene from another species. It’s called genetic modification (GM) or transgenics. These "genetically-modified organisms," (GMOs) allow the Roundup to kill the weeds, but spare the crops. Hence the term, "Roundup-Ready" (RR).


In addition to food crops, forestry companies use Roundup (and similar formulations) to keep down unwanted weed growth which would otherwise smother re-plantings after clear-cutting. 


Then, there is its so-called "cosmetic use" on lawns and gardens to keep them free of such nuisance weeds as dandelions. Use of Roundup for these purposes has now been restricted in Quebec and Ontario. Manitoba is now considering a similar ban. While these "cosmetic uses" are coming under increasing regulatory scrutiny, use of the product in agriculture and forestry is largely uncontrolled.


Roundup has, for years, been the top-selling herbicide for the company that makes it, US-based Monsanto, and a key to its enormous commercial success. Monsanto is also a world leader in the production of GMOs. There are now almost 200 "copy-cat" formulations of Roundup under different brand names on the market. But Roundup, first registered in 1976, still dominates.


And, it works. "RR" crops are, for the most part, clean and weed-free. 


But an examination of the research done into the safety of Roundup over the years, offers many disturbing glimpses into a product which achieves such pristine monocultures. 


Soy Story - The Argentine Experience


Argentina has seen an explosion in plantings of "Roundup-Ready" soybeans in the past decade or so; 19 million hectares (47 million acres) in 2009 alone. This has meant a corresponding spike in the use of Roundup, to an estimated 200 million litres a year. 


Other countries in South America, including Brazil, have experienced similar upward spirals in soy production. 


Well over 90 percent of soybean crops have been genetically-modified and therefore require Roundup to succeed.


Just over a year ago, a team of international experts published what was (for a scientific research paper), a surprisingly damning indictment, not only of glyphosate, but of the very wisdom and sustainability of government ventures into vastly-expanded soybean production. 


The study, called, "GM Soy. Sustainable? Responsible?" not only published results of research done by team members themselves, but summarized research done elsewhere. And it documented the findings of a commission conducted by the central Argentinian State of Chaco in 2010. 


The Commission found that, from 2000 to 2009, childhood cancer rates tripled in the town of La Leonesa and birth defects increased almost fourfold over the entire state. Those results corresponded with greatly increased spraying of glyphosate and other agrochemicals in the region during that period. 


Scientific studies referred to in the paper, cite an association between glyphosate and at least two kinds of cancer, multiple myeloma and non-Hodgkin's lymphoma, (NHL), a cancer of the blood. An increased rate of NHL had been repeatedly observed among farmers for years, suggesting an association between use of pesticides, including glyphosate and the risk of the disease.


In laboratory tests, one team member, AndrƩs Carrasco of the University of Buenos Aires, found that glyphosate causes malformations in frog & chicken embryos similar to those in humans, at one-tenth the rate allowed in Argentina.


In an obvious attempt to counter critics who claim that lab tests are really "engineered" scenarios which don't truly replicate real situations, Prof. Carrasco noted that "experimental animals share similar developmental mechanisms with humans."


Many authors have reported that in the past 30 years there has been a significant decline in amphibian populations in several different parts of the world. 


In 2005, a researcher at the University of Pittsburgh, Rick Relyea, carried out seemingly-convincing research which pointed the finger directly at Roundup. He concluded that Roundup "Can cause extremely high rates of mortality to amphibians that could lead to population declines."  Prof. Relyea, of the University's Department of Biological Sciences, noted that earlier tests in the laboratory had already shown that the herbicide may be highly lethal to North American tadpoles. So he set up tests exposing three species of frogs, both larvae and juveniles, to Roundup, outdoors, in what he called "more natural conditions. After a single day, "the Roundup had killed up to 86% of the juveniles and, in three weeks, up to 100% of the larvae." 

The Canadian reaction


While Canadian plantings of soybeans pale in comparison to Argentina's, they are growing rapidly. According to the Canadian Soybean Council, overall soybean production reached a new high of 1.5 million hectares (3.7 million acres) in 2010, an 8-fold increase over 1973.


Even if one removes the soybean sector from the equation, Roundup use on GM canola (oilseed) crops in Canada is massive and has been growing since that crop came into widespread use on the prairies. Actual figures on the use of Roundup itself are hard to come by. But, according to the Canola Council of Canada, seeded acreage grew, from 4% of total canola acreage in 1996 to 70% in 2000! And the Council hopes to boost canola production by 65%, to 15 million tonnes by 2015.


Yet Canadian farmers don't seem to be buying into the horror stories emerging out of Argentina. 


Take Ron Gendzelevich, for example. He owns "Quarry Seed" on a 4,000-acre farm near Stonewall, Manitoba, north of Winnipeg. He describes his farm as an "experimental ground" where he sources hardy varieties of edible soybeans for northern climates and sells them. He also conducts workshops, advising other growers on best varieties, application rates and other planting tips. While he handles conventional (non GM) soy, he says 80% of it is "Roundup Ready."


Gendzelevich says, "I'm probably the first one to defend the environment." But, "For the most part, urban people just don't understand. You look at every crop out there, wheat, oats, beans, it's been genetically modified of some format. GM has been given a monster terminology that just isn't justified in most cases. Given the number of people we have to feed, we've got to make and grow as much as we can. The bigger issue is world population. If we are going to allow it to grow unchecked, we have to boost production because, which is better, to have a slightly safer world, with people starving, or a very small degree of risk with people being fed? That's the bigger question."


Gendzelevich adds, other farmers are using chemicals on other crops which are even more toxic than Roundup, including 2-4-D. "When I went to convert soybeans to RR, my Roundup use went up massively but my overall herbicide use went down dramatically. That's because you're dealing with a product that has the ability to kill weeds a little bit better. Before, you had to use 3 or 4 herbicides to do the overall same job as one can do and I think what you're finding is, you were putting a substantial amount more herbicides or chemicals on the ground in the olden days than today."


The soybean producer admits he doesn't know a lot about the Argentine experience. But, "I see a person swigging whisky and smoking, talking about how farmers are poisoning the world, I don't take 'em with any respect. Whether it's detergents, to all the different chemicals that you have from your furniture to your desktops to all kinds of stuff like that, and to associate birth defects with Roundup? I don't get it. I'm not implying Roundup is safe, just implying that there are so many different chemicals used in the environment today, the jacket you wear…and to say that Roundup is the cause, I'd like to see the evidence." 


The evidence.


A body of research done here in Canada more than a decade ago, pointed to a somewhat different conclusion and, at the same time, seemed to counter claims by its maker, Monsanto, that Roundup is safe.


In 1997, The Ontario Farm Family Health Study surveyed almost 19 hundred male farmers in Ontario who'd been exposed to several chemicals, including glyphosate in their faming activities. It concluded that their partners were "more than twice as likely" to miscarry or give birth, prematurely.


In 2,001 another phase of the same study, surveyed almost 4 thousand pregnant farm women in the same province. All had been involved in farming activities, milking cows, cultivating or seeding the fields and sometimes helping their partners mix and apply the herbicides. 395 of those women experienced miscarriages. All had been exposed to a variety of pesticides, including glyphosate. 


In the words of the study, "Among older women (over 34) exposed to glyphosate, the risk of miscarriage was three times that for women of the same age who were not exposed to this active ingredient."


The French connection


In 2009 (and earlier), laboratory findings by a leading French researcher, Gilles-Eric SĆ©ralini, proved consistent with that Canadian research. In his lab at the University of Caen, the molecular biologist demonstrated that, within 24 hours, the active ingredient in Roundup, glyphosate, was totally lethal to three different kinds of human cells (umbilical, embryonic and placental), at just a fraction of the concentrations used in agriculture and equal to those found in human and animal feed! 

 

SĆ©ralini was "surprised" to also discover that other ingredients in Roundup, besides glyphosate, were not the harmless substances the public had been led to believe. On the contrary, Roundup, as a mixture, was, in every test, always twice as deadly  as glyphosate alone! One of those other ingredients (polyoxyethylene tallow amines, POEA), stated the researcher, has been clinically shown to cause "high mortality in fish and amphibians." Regulators had been legally classifying  "POEA" as simply "inert."


He also concluded, "Its residues may thus enter the food chain, and glyphosate is found as a contaminant in rivers."


SƩralini also concluded glyphosate is probably an "endocrine disruptor." That means it can affect the human brain, nervous and reproductive systems, even blood sugar levels by disrupting the normal functioning of hormones in the human body, including estrogen and testosterone.


Can Roundup (glyphosate) actually damage crops?


Extensive, multi-year research by an Agriculture Canada team led by Miriam Fernandez, published some two years ago, showed that use of glyphosate was actually a significant factor in the incidence of Fusarium head blight (FHB) and Common root rot (CRR) in wheat and barley crops planted up to 18 months after such application. Both FHB and CRR are considered serious diseases in these important cereal crops in places like eastern Saskatchewan, where the trials were conducted. The study appeared in the European Journal of Agronomy in 2009. While tillage practices were also found to have some effect, the team concluded, "Previous glyphosate use was consistently associated with higher FHB levels" … and "significantly increased" risk of the plant diseases. 


The court ruling 


In November, the Federal Court of Canada heard a complaint launched by Josette Wier, an environmental activist from the north-central BC town of Smithers. She was the same person who had been turned down after requesting the Minister to conduct a special review. Under Canada's Pest Control Products Act, anyone may ask for such a review, which the Minister "shall perform, unless there is reasonable certainty that no harm will result from exposure to the pesticide." 


Ms. Wier, the "applicant," had grown concerned that herbicides similar to Roundup, which logging companies were spraying on forests near her home, were harmful to human health and the environment. (The two products were "Vision," by Monsanto and "Vantage" by DowAgro. Both contain that suspect ingredient mentioned earlier, POEA. It apparently allows the glyphosate to spread more evenly on the waxy surface of leaves.) 


The applicant cited several studies already mentioned in this story, in documents she presented to the court. But during the proceedings, the judge, Mr. Justice Kelen, narrowed the case down to this: were those herbicides, "Vision" and "Vantage," harming frogs and salamanders in "transitory wetlands" (ones which come and go), in clear cut areas where the forest has been directly sprayed and replanted. He found that there wasn't enough information on this potential aspect and that the Minister's 2009 decision was neither "transparent or intelligible" in this regard. 


The court also found that Ms. Aglukkaq "erred in law" by arguing that a "special review" was not needed because a routine re-evaluation is underway. The judge found that it does not have to be one or the other - both are allowed to "co-exist" under the legislation. He found further that a special review could be both "targeted and possibly quicker" than the re-evaluation.

 

So just how binding is the ruling?


Despite its seemingly stern tone, the ruling isn't really binding at all. As Andrew Baumberge of the Federal Court of Canada explains, "The courts should not interfere with the exercise of a discretion by a statutory authority merely because the court might have exercised the discretion in a different manner… The Court is not meant to make the decision in the place of the federal government office/official"


At the time of this writing, some ten weeks after the judgement, a spokesperson at Health Canada says the Minister is still "reconsidering" the matter.


Any Lessons Learned?


If there are lessons to be learned from all of this, it's not clear just what they are. Soy, for example, is still being hailed at Canadian agricultural gatherings as the "Cinderella" crop of the future. And public discourse on the downsides of GM crops ranges from little to none.

Few Creatures Big or Small, Escape the Ravages of a Warming Planet

The Plight of the "Red Mason"

By Larry Powell

    In a study released today, scientists in Poland reveal some, if not surprising, certainly disturbing discoveries. 

    When exposed to even short periods of extreme heat in a lab (the kind that's increasing globally due to manmade climate change), larvae of one of several species of red mason bees (osmia bicornis) emerged as smaller adults with reduced wing size. It was harder for them to take off and, when they did, they flew more slowly and for shorter distances. 

    The research team ominously concludes: "As climate change intensifies heatwaves, such carry-over effects may reduce pollinator mobility, foraging efficiency, and ecosystem services."

     The osmia bicornis is found in Europe, North Africa, and parts of western and northern Asia. It was introduced to North America and has now been recorded in Ontario and Nova Scotia. Other kinds of red masons are considered invasive species in North America. No such designation  seems to have been attached to the osmia bicornis so far.

As a matter-of-fact, the "Bumblebee Conservation Trust (UK), has nothing but praise for that particular bee. "The osmia bicornis are approachable and docile little bees which aren't given to stinging and so are safe around children and pets. Like all bees it is only the females that carry a sting and it's been said that the only way a female red mason will sting you is if you roll her between your fingers! 

    "They're hugely beneficial to our gardens and crops as they're excellent pollinators of fruit trees, together with a wide range of wildflowers. A single female red mason bee can do the work of 120 honeybees and may in the future be commercially reared to pollinate fruit orchards in the U.K."

    The study has just been published by The Royal Society.
